Bring the nostalgic warmth and elegance of yesteryear to your tree with this unique Christmas ornament.
Delft Blue Vintage Check This pendant truly exudes the atmosphere of yesteryear and makes a stylish and timeless eye-catcher during the holidays.
 
The Christmas ornament is crafted from high-quality white ceramic and designed in a beautiful, elongated diamond shape that immediately brings to mind antique Christmas decorations.
 
The ornament is decorated all around with refined, traditional Delft blue motifs.
